Editors

About the Role

Editors are professionals who review, revise, and enhance written content to ensure clarity, coherence, and adherence to specific standards.

Other Common Titles

  • Copy Editor
  • Content Editor
  • Managing Editor
  • Acquisitions Editor
  • Production Editor
  • Technical Editor

Typical Tasks

  • Review and edit written content for clarity and coherence.
  • Check grammatical errors and correct punctuation.
  • Ensure adherence to style guides and publication standards.
  • Fact-check information and verify sources.
  • Collaborate with writers to improve narrative and structure.
  • Provide feedback and suggestions on content revisions.
  • Manage deadlines and coordinate with other production staff.

Notable People

  • William Strunk Jr. Co-author of 'The Elements of Style', a foundational text in the field of writing and editing.
  • Max Perkins Renowned editor known for working with notable authors like F. Scott Fitzgerald and Ernest Hemingway.
  • Robert Gottlieb Prominent book editor who has shaped the careers of numerous celebrated authors.
